Richard G. Gould joined the Board of Trustees of each Fund as an Independent Trustee effective June 1, 2024. As a result, all references to 10 Trustees are hereby deleted and replaced with 11 Trustees. In addition, references to the Compliance and Insurance Committee and Equity Investment Committee membership are hereby amended to reflect that Mr. Gould is a member of each such Committee.

The following is hereby added to the section of the Funds' Statements of Additional Information titled "Management of the Fund—Experience, Qualifications and Attributes":

With over 30 years of global experience in the financial services industry, Mr. Gould brings extensive expertise in managing and developing diverse businesses within financial organizations. Mr. Gould's approach to management combines strategic perspective with deep global operations experience. Throughout his career in finance, he has held executive positions at firms including Lehman Brothers, Morgan Stanley, Information Services Group (ISG), Bloomberg LP, and CLSA Americas (CLSA). Mr. Gould began his career as an equity derivatives options trader at Lehman Brothers. He then transitioned to Morgan Stanley to start its Non-US Derivatives and Global Portfolio trading business, where he eventually became a Managing Director and held a diverse set of senior positions, heading the firm's various business lines in New York, London, and Tokyo. After his tenure with Morgan Stanley, Mr. Gould began a new venture as a Founding Member and Executive Vice President of ISG, a special purpose acquisition company. After successfully taking ISG public, Mr. Gould joined Bloomberg Tradebook as its Head of Global Sales and built a sales organization around the firm's fixed income, equities derivatives, FX products, and logarithmic trading platform. Mr. Gould next held Chairman, CEO, and other executive roles within CLSA and its global affiliates. At CLSA, he provided strategic leadership for the company and its affiliates, establishing and implementing long range goals, strategies, plans, and policies. He was also a member of the CLSA Global Management Committee and the CLSA Broking Executive Committee, further contributing to his governance experience.
